diff options
author | Artem Dyomin <artem.dyomin@qt.io> | 2023-04-17 16:17:59 +0200 |
---|---|---|
committer | Artem Dyomin <artem.dyomin@qt.io> | 2023-05-30 18:34:20 +0000 |
commit | f93fa5ab5196aa5135bd404d15bf5884546a6feb (patch) | |
tree | 077c02a2c300d1d80eab5734bb14f7dd6273e7b8 /tests/auto/integration/qcamerabackend/tst_qcamerabackend.cpp | |
parent | 5aa899abb67ebdbcc9d0feb994385f1ab12656f7 (diff) |
Fix some qmediaplayer tests flackiness
Outputs should be removed after QMediaPlayer to
avoid having broken references inside the player.
Handling of the outputs deleting will be done under
the task QTBUG-114072 with new specific unit test case.
This patch fixes tests flakiness that improves CI behavior.
Task-number: QTBUG-114072
Pick-to: 6.5
Change-Id: I0f4f4a2e9152a2a4dd9572d8060586ee6fb1d647
Reviewed-by: Lars Knoll <lars@knoll.priv.no>
Reviewed-by: Qt CI Bot <qt_ci_bot@qt-project.org>
Diffstat (limited to 'tests/auto/integration/qcamerabackend/tst_qcamerabackend.cpp')
-rw-r--r-- | tests/auto/integration/qcamerabackend/tst_qcamerabackend.cpp | 2 |
1 files changed, 1 insertions, 1 deletions
diff --git a/tests/auto/integration/qcamerabackend/tst_qcamerabackend.cpp b/tests/auto/integration/qcamerabackend/tst_qcamerabackend.cpp index 91f397528..39d2b294a 100644 --- a/tests/auto/integration/qcamerabackend/tst_qcamerabackend.cpp +++ b/tests/auto/integration/qcamerabackend/tst_qcamerabackend.cpp @@ -674,8 +674,8 @@ void tst_QCameraBackend::testNativeMetadata() // QMediaRecorder::metaData() can only test that QMediaMetaData is set properly on the recorder. // Use QMediaPlayer to test that the native metadata is properly set on the track - QMediaPlayer player; QAudioOutput output; + QMediaPlayer player; player.setAudioOutput(&output); QSignalSpy metadataChangedSpy(&player, SIGNAL(metaDataChanged())); |